UP Will Soon Be Known As Most Modern State With Next-Generation Infra: PM

Mumbai: PM Narendra Modi on Saturday, after laying the foundation stone of Ganga Expressway, said Uttar Pradesh will soon be identified as the “most modern state”, with the next-generation infrastructure being built by the double-engine government.

Addressing the program, the Prime Minister said, “Maa Ganga is the source of all happiness and prosperity. Mother Ganga gives all happiness and removes all sorrows. Similarly, Ganga Expressway will also open new doors for the prosperity of Uttar Pradesh. New expressways, airports and railway lines will prove to be boons for the people of the state. When the whole of Uttar Pradesh grows together, the nation progresses. Therefore, the focus of the ‘double engine’ government is on the development of Uttar Pradesh.”

Attacking the previous governments of Uttar Pradesh, PM Modi said, “Remember the situation of five years ago. Except in some areas of the state, there was no electricity in other cities and villages. But today the money of Uttar Pradesh is being invested in the development of the state. The modern infrastructure that is being created in Uttar Pradesh today shows how the resources are used properly.”

“The day is not far when UP will be recognized as the most modern state with next-generation infrastructure. The network of expressways in UP, the new airports being built, new rail routes being laid down are bringing several blessings to people of UP simultaneously,” PM Modi said.

He said the “double engine” government not only gave about 80 lakh free electricity connections in Uttar Pradesh but every district is being given much more electricity than before.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ath and Deputy Chief Minister Keshav Prasad Maurya were also present at the inauguration event.

According to the Prime Minister’s Office (PMO), the expressway is behind the Prime Minister’s vision to provide fast-paced connectivity across the country. The 594 km long six-lane expressway will be built at a cost of over Rs 36,200 crore.

Starting from near Bijauli village of Meerut, this expressway will go to Judapur Dandu village of Prayagraj. It will pass through Meerut, Hapur, Bulandshahr, Amroha, Sambhal, Badaun, Shahjahanpur, Hardoi, Unnao, Rae Bareli, Pratapgarh and Prayagraj.

The Ganga Expressway was approved on November 26, 2020. This expressway will be completed by 2024. Assembly elections in Uttar Pradesh are slated for early next year.
